MRSH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

1,572 of the 7,619 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Marsh (MRSH)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$87.2B — down 10% from $97.1B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 154 funds closed out of MRSH and 147 opened new positions — a net loss of 7 holders — while 607 trimmed existing stakes and 559 added.

The largest buyer was ClearBridge Investments, adding an estimated $402M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$737M.
